How much does it cost to rent a home in Waterloo?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Waterloo 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,142 | $650 | $3,433 |
Waterloo 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,260 | $825 | $2,175 |
Waterloo 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,795 | $875 | $2,700 |
Waterloo 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,741 | $1,050 | $2,375 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Waterloo
What type of rentals are currently available in Waterloo?
There are currently 227 Apartments for Rent in Waterloo, IA with pricing that ranges from $425 to $3,433. There are also 116 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Waterloo ranging from $550 to $3,433.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Waterloo?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Waterloo ranges from $550 to $3,433 with an average monthly rent of $1,245.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Waterloo?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Waterloo range from $505 to $1,950,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$825 to $2,175.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$875 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$425.
